Food & Dining in Tempuran
What to Eat and Where to Find It in Tempuran
Tempuran, located within the rich culinary landscape of Indonesia, offers a delightful array of traditional Javanese dishes that are a must-try for any visitor. Central to the local diet are staples like Nasi Goreng (fried rice) and Mie Goreng (fried noodles), often prepared with a unique local twist. make sure to visit on Gudeg, a sweet jackfruit stew originating from nearby Yogyakarta, which is a true Javanese delicacy. For those seeking something heartier, Sate Ayam (chicken satay) with its flavourful peanut sauce is a universally loved option, and Sop Buntut (oxtail soup) offers a rich, comforting broth that is perfect for any time of day.
When it comes to dining locations, Tempuran and its surrounding areas provide a spectrum of choices. For an authentic street food experience, explore the local markets and night bazaars, particularly in areas like South Magelang and Central Magelang, where vendors offer a variety of affordable and delicious snacks and meals. For those seeking Halal-certified options, which are abundant given Indonesia's Muslim majority, look for restaurants displaying the Halal logo or inquire with your hotel. Many local eateries are accustomed to catering to Halal dietary needs, ensuring a comfortable dining experience for Muslim travellers.
The cost of dining in Tempuran offers excellent value for international travellers. Street food and local warungs typically range from ₱30 to ₱70 (approximately $0.50 to $1.20 USD), making it incredibly budget-friendly. Mid-range restaurants offering a more comfortable dining experience will generally cost between ₱150 to ₱300 (approximately $3 to $6 USD) per person for a full meal. Even more upscale dining establishments are considerably more affordable than in Western countries, with a three-course meal for two costing around ₱700 to ₱1,500 (approximately $15 to $30 USD), offering a great opportunity to explore diverse flavours without breaking the bank.
Navigating dining etiquette in Tempuran is straightforward and contributes to a pleasant experience. It is customary to eat with your right hand, especially when dining at local eateries or from communal dishes, though utensils are readily available in most restaurants. Tipping is not mandatory but is appreciated for exceptional service, with a small amount of around 5-10% being customary. Meal times are generally flexible, with breakfast, lunch, and dinner following typical international schedules. Showing respect for local customs, such as dressing modestly when entering food establishments, will be well-received.
Cultural Norms and Staying Safe in Tempuran
Understanding local customs is key to a respectful and enjoyable visit to Tempuran. Javanese culture places a high value on politeness, respect, and maintaining harmony. Greetings are typically warm and friendly, often accompanied by a slight bow or nod. When interacting with locals, it's advisable to use polite language and avoid overly direct or confrontational communication. Public displays of affection should be kept to a minimum, and it's important to be mindful of elders and those in positions of authority, showing them due deference.
When visiting religious sites or temples in and around Tempuran, such as the magnificent Borobudur, modest dress is essential. This typically means covering your shoulders and knees. It's also customary to remove your shoes before entering homes or places of worship. Photography is generally permitted in most tourist areas, but always be respectful and ask for permission before taking close-up photos of individuals, especially in more traditional settings. Queue culture is generally relaxed, but patience and politeness are always appreciated.
Safety in Tempuran is generally good, with petty crime being relatively low in tourist areas. However, as with any travel destination, it's wise to take precautions. Keep your valuables secure and be aware of your surroundings, especially in crowded markets or on public transport. For transportation, reputable ride-hailing apps like Grab are widely available and offer a convenient and relatively safe way to get around. It's always a good idea to have offline maps downloaded and to share your travel plans with someone back home.
For Filipino travellers, it's important to be aware of emergency procedures. The local emergency number for police and ambulance is 112. While there isn't a Philippine Embassy in Tempuran itself, the Philippine Embassy in Jakarta is the primary point of contact for consular assistance. It's advisable to have their contact details readily available. For health concerns, ensure you have adequate travel insurance that covers medical emergencies. Staying informed about any advisories from the Philippine Department of Foreign Affairs (DFA) before your trip is also recommended.
Getting to Tempuran and Getting Around
Reaching Tempuran from the Philippines is a journey that typically involves flights to a major Indonesian gateway, followed by onward travel. Direct flights from Manila (MNL) or Cebu (CEB) to Indonesia are common, usually landing in Jakarta (CGK) or sometimes Surabaya (SUB). From these hubs, you would then connect to a domestic flight to airports serving the Tempuran region, such as Adisutjipto International Airport (JOG) in Yogyakarta or Ahmad Yani International Airport (SRG) in Semarang. Flight durations can vary, with total travel time often ranging from 8 to 15 hours, depending on layovers. Estimated costs for round-trip flights from the Philippines can range from ₱15,000 to ₱30,000, depending on the season and booking time. Once you arrive at the nearest airport serving Tempuran, such as Yogyakarta or Semarang, ground transportation is readily available to take you to your accommodation. Options include pre-booked private transfers, airport taxis, or ride-hailing services like Grab. The journey to Tempuran itself can take anywhere from 1 to 3 hours, depending on your final destination within the region and traffic conditions. Within Tempuran, local transportation primarily consists of ride-hailing apps, taxis, and for shorter distances, motorcycle taxis (ojek) or becaks (cycle rickshaws). Renting a car with a driver is also a popular and convenient option for exploring the wider area, especially for visiting multiple attractions.
The best time to visit Tempuran generally aligns with Indonesia's dry season, which typically runs from May to September. During these months, you can expect sunny days and lower humidity, making it ideal for outdoor activities and sightseeing, including visits to historical sites like Borobudur. The shoulder months of April and October can also offer pleasant weather with fewer crowds. While the wet season (November to March) brings occasional rain showers, it also means lower hotel prices and fewer tourists, which can be appealing for budget-conscious travellers or those seeking a more tranquil experience.
Before embarking on your trip to Tempuran, a few pre-departure preparations are essential. The local currency is the Indonesian Rupiah (IDR). While major credit cards are accepted in hotels and larger establishments, it's advisable to carry some cash for smaller purchases, local markets, and transportation. You can exchange currency at the airport or in local banks. Purchasing a local SIM card upon arrival at the airport is recommended for easy data access, enabling the use of navigation and ride-hailing apps. Essential apps to download include Google Maps, Google Translate, and the Grab app.
Visa Information
Entering Indonesia to Visit Tempuran: Visa Requirements
For Philippine passport holders planning a trip to Tempuran, Indonesia, the visa requirements are generally favourable. As of current regulations, Filipino citizens are typically granted visa-free entry into Indonesia for short stays, usually up to 30 days. This allows for convenient travel for tourism purposes without the need for a pre-arranged visa. It is crucial, however, to ensure your passport has at least six months of validity remaining from your date of entry into Indonesia and that you possess proof of onward travel, such as a return or onward flight ticket.
The application process for visa-free entry is straightforward, requiring no prior application or fees for eligible nationalities like Filipinos for short tourist stays. Upon arrival at the Indonesian immigration checkpoint, you will present your passport and may be asked to show your return ticket or proof of sufficient funds for your stay. While visa-free entry is common, it is always recommended to verify the latest regulations with the Embassy of the Republic of Indonesia in the Philippines or the Directorate General of Immigration of Indonesia before your travel, as policies can be subject to change.
